Post by Tonysal123 » Wed Aug 10, 2016 5:05 pm

I used lithium grease

To remove the knobs, use a piece of string or two to help pull up each knob. Check out this link :

http://bustedgear.com/repair_Moog_micro_envelope.html


I use KemWipes with alcohol 99% pure to clean insides. And simple soapy water solution for the outside.
